1941 Simca 5 vs. 2008 Daewoo Tocsa
To start off, 2008 Daewoo Tocsa is newer by 67 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1941 Simca 5.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1941 Simca 5 would be higher. At 1,991 cc (4 cylinders), 2008 Daewoo Tocsa is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Daewoo Tocsa (148 HP) has 134 more horse power than 1941 Simca 5. (14 HP) In normal driving conditions, 2008 Daewoo Tocsa should accelerate faster than 1941 Simca 5.
Because 1941 Simca 5 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1941 Simca 5.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2008 Daewoo Tocsa,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
